Synopsis "Cultural Influences on Economic Analysis: Theory and Empirical Evidence"
This book examines the influences of various cultural factors on economic analyses that could be misrepresented by existing economic theories. The book's most significant contribution is the measuring of cultural diversity and bilateral similarity indexes of the existing 200 or more countries and regions, as well as to quantify their impacts on economic activities. This book also clarifies conditions under which cultural difference may not become a cause of misunderstanding and conflict, but a source of creativity and profitability for economic development.
